Weight regainafter stopping GLP-1 The journey to weight loss with medications like semaglutide has offered a promising avenue for many. However, a crucial question that arises for those considering or undergoing such treatment is: what happens to the lost weight when semaglutide is discontinued? Research indicates that semaglutide weight regain is a significant concern, with a substantial portion of individuals experiencing a return of lost pounds after stopping the medication. This article delves into the current understanding of semaglutide weight regain based on available scientific data, aiming to provide a comprehensive overview for those seeking information.Trajectory of the body weight after drug discontinuation in the ...

Further analysis by M Quarenghi in 2025 also reported similar findings, with semaglutide and placebo participants regaining 11.6 (SD: 7.7) and 1.9 (SD: 4.8) percentage points of lost weight by week 120 after treatment cessation.
The rate at which this weight regain occurs is also a key point of discussion. The timeframe for weight regain after stopping semaglutide is also a critical factor. While some individuals might maintain their lost weight for a period, studies suggest a predictable pattern of regain. For instance, a 2026 study noted that semaglutide weight regain can begin quite soon after cessation, with weight showing significant regain in as little as 8 weeks after treatment discontinuation and continuing on a rising trend. However, it's not a universal experience for everyone. While many patients find they regain weight after stopping semaglutide, not all doWeight regain and cardiometabolic effects after withdrawal of .... A study from 2024 found that 17.7% of patients regained all the weight they had lost or even exceeded their initial weight. This suggests that individual responses can vary. Furthermore, ongoing treatment with semaglutide has been shown to be effective in maintaining weight loss.
